JSON_INSERT

说明 若input参数包含数组数组中的JSON内容插入规则,假设input中数组的长度为n,指定插入的位置为m时:如果 m>=n,在数组末尾添加value。如果 m,在数组开头添加value。如果-n,根据insert_after的确定添加value的位置。若...

数组函数和操作符

array_prepend(anyelement,anyarray)→anyarray array_prepend(1,ARRAY[2,3])→{1,2,3} 从数组中移除与给定相等的所有元素。数必须是一维的。使用 IS NOT DISTINCT FROM 语义完成比较,所以可以删除 NULL。array_remove(anyarray,...

数组函数

array_prepend(1,ARRAY[2,3]){1,2,3} array_remove(anyarray,anyelement)ARRAY 从数组中移除所有等于给定值的所有元素。array_remove(ARRAY[1,2,3,2],2){1,3} array_sort(anyarray)ARRAY 对数元素进行排序。Hologres从 V1.1.46版本开始...

云产品集成KMS凭据

部分云产品集成了KMS凭据,通过在云产品中配置凭据名称,云产品KMS中获取凭据后用于相关操作,使您需要在云产品中使用的敏感凭据始终处于系统化的安全管控中,避免人工保管失误导致凭据信息泄露。背景信息 为避免在代码中硬编码凭据...

使用Python SDK管理机器

已创建机器组中获取机器名称。group_name="ali-test-machinegroup"if_name_='_main_':print("ready to update machinegroup")#调用接口查询待修改的机器配置信息。print("Before update,the machine list is:")res=client.get_...

通用聚合函数

函数名 描述 用例 结果 array_agg(anyelement)将表达式的串联到数组中。暂不支持JSON、JSONB、TIMETZ、INTERVAL、INET、OID、UUID数据类型和数类型。array_agg(c1){1,2} {true,false} {a,b} {1.1,2.2} avg(bigint)求BIGINT类型表达式...

聚合函数

max_by(x,y,n)→array<[与x类型相同]>x 与 y 的全部关联中,以 y 降序排列前 n 个最大值所关联的 x 值中,返回前 n 个值 min_by(x,y)→[与x类型相同]返回 x 与 y 的全部关联中,y 最小值所关联的第一个 x 值。min_by(x,y,n)→array<[与x...

ARRAY_MAX

计算ARRAY数组 a 的最大元素。命令格式 T array_max(array<T><a>)参数说明 a:必填。ARRAY数组。array的 T 指代ARRAY数组元素的数据类型。数组中的元素可以为如下类型:TINYINT、SMALLINT、INT、BIGINT FLOAT、DOUBLE BOOLEAN DECIMAL...

ARRAY_MIN

计算ARRAY数组 a 的最小元素。命令格式 T array_min(array<T><a>)参数说明 a:必填。ARRAY数组。array的 T 指代ARRAY数组元素的数据类型。数组中的元素可以为如下类型:TINYINT、SMALLINT、INT、BIGINT FLOAT、DOUBLE BOOLEAN DECIMAL...

CONCAT

将多个ARRAY数组中的所有元素连接在一起,生成一个新的ARRAY数组,或将多个字符串连接在一起,生成一个新的字符串。命令格式 array<T>concat(array<T><a>,array<T><b>[,.])string concat(string,string[,.])参数说明 a、b:必填。ARRAY数组...

MULTIMAP_FROM_ENTRIES

返回由结构体数组中的Key和包含所有Value的数组所组成的Map。命令格式 multimap_from_entries(array,V>>)参数说明 array,V>>:为Key/Value组成的结构体数组。返回说明 返回由结构体数组中的Key和包含所有Value的数组所组成的Map,Map格式...

数组函数和运算符

示例 提取二维数组中索引相同的元素组成一个新的二维数组,例如数组[0,1,2,3]、[10,19,18,17]、[9,8,7]的0、10、9的索引都为1,则组成数组[0.0,10.0,9.0]。查询和分析语句*|SELECT array_transpose(array[array[0,1,2,3],array[10,19,18,...

函数概览

json_extract函数 JSON对象或JSON数组中提取一JSON数组或对象)。json_extract_scalar函数 JSON对象或JSON数组中提取一标量值(字符串、整数或布尔)。类似于json_extract函数。json_format函数 把JSON类型转化成字符串类型...

iOS SDK开发指南

自动感知网络环境(ipv4-only、ipv6-only、ipv4和ipv6双栈)直接缓存中获取适用于当前网络环境的ip数组,无需等待./如无缓存,则返回 nil;如果有缓存并且enable设为YES,则会返回缓存数据给用户,若缓存数据过期则异步解析域名更新缓存...

MAP_FROM_ARRAYS

如果 a 元素包含NULL或两个数组长度不相等,会返回报错。使用示例-返回{1:2,3:4}。select map_from_arrays(array(1.0,3.0),array('2','4'));返回{1:2,3:6}。select map_from_arrays('last_win',array(1.0,3.0,3),array('2','4','6'));...

UDF示例:获取字符串(不含分隔符)Value

keyname:待获取值所对应的键名称,STRING类型,必填。开发和使用步骤 1.代码开发 Java UDF 代码示例 package com.aliyun.rewrite;package名称,可以根据您的情况定义。import com.aliyun.odps.udf.UDF;import java.util.HashMap;import ...

ARRAY_EXCEPT

找出在ARRAY数组 a ,但不在ARRAY数组 b 的元素,并去掉重复的元素后,返回新的ARRAY数组。命令格式 array<T>array_except(array<T><a>,array<T><b>)参数说明 a、b:必填。ARRAY数组。array的 T 指代ARRAY数组元素的数据类型,数组中...

ARRAY_INTERSECT

MaxCompute ARRAY_INTERSECT函数用于计算两个ARRAY数组之间的交集,并返回一个包含两个数组中都存在的相同值的新数组。本文为您介绍ARRAY_INTERSECT函数的命令格式、参数说明以及使用示例。命令格式 array<T>array_intersect(array<T><a>,...

ARRAY_DISTINCT

去除ARRAY数组 a 的重复元素。命令格式 array<T>array_distinct(array<T><a>)参数说明 a:必填。ARRAY数组。array的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。返回说明 返回ARRAY类型。返回规则如下:新ARRAY...

ALL_MATCH

判断ARRAY数组 a 是否所有元素都满足 predicate 条件。命令格式 boolean all_match(array<T><a>,function,boolean>)参数说明 a:必填。ARRAY数组。array的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。predicate:必...

ANY_MATCH

判断ARRAY数组 a 是否存在元素满足 predicate 条件。命令格式 boolean any_match(array<T><a>,function,boolean>)参数说明 a:必填。ARRAY数组。array的 T 指代ARRAY数组元素的数据类型,数组中的元素可以为任意类型。predicate:必填...

ZIP_WITH

将ARRAY数组 a 和 b 的元素按照位置,使用 combiner 进行元素级别的合并,返回一个新的ARRAY数组。命令格式 array<R>zip_with(array<T><a>,array<S><b>,function,S,R>)参数说明 a、b:必填。ARRAY数组。array、array的 T、S 指代ARRAY...

ARRAY_REMOVE

在ARRAY数组 a 删除与 element 相等的元素。命令格式 array<T>array_remove(array<T><a>,T)参数说明 a:必填。ARRAY数组。array的 T 指代ARRAY数组元素的数据类型。支持的数据类型如下:TINYINT、SMALLINT、INT、BIGINT FLOAT、DOUBLE ...

JSON类型

还有,如果一个值中的 JSON 对象包含同一个键超过一次,所有的键/值对都会被保留(处理函数会把最后的值当作有效值)。相反,jsonb 不保留空格、不保留对象键的顺序并且不保留重复的对象键。如果在输入中指定了重复的键,只有最后一个值会...

FLATTEN

数组类型的数组转换为单个数组。命令格式 flatten(arrayOfArray)参数说明 arrayOfArray:为数类型的数组。返回说明 将数组类型的数组按元素顺序展开为单个数组。如果输入为 null,则返回NULL。如果输入参数不是数组类型的数组,则...

聚石塔 Postman 接口使用指南

更准确地是接口中获取,参考 接口文档:两者若不同,以接口为准。ivsAppKey 参考 接口文档:ivsAppKey 为上图中的 App Key,务必传对,否则无法计分。创建用户流程 获取 AccessToken 获取 AccessToken,为后续接口提供认证需要的 token...

ARRAYS_ZIP

合并多个给定数并返回一个结构数组,其中第N个结构包含输入数组的所有第N个。命令格式 array,U,.>>arrays_zip(array<T><a>,array<U><b>[,.])参数说明 a、b:必填。ARRAY数组。array及 array的 T 和 U 指代ARRAY数组元素的数据类型,...

迭代器功能说明

单元中组件的数据可由自身数据源驱动,或者迭代器中获取。重要 迭代器的一级子图层只能是迭代单元,不能是普通组件,普通组件包含在迭代单元内。迭代器功能操作 操作 说明 生成迭代器 在区块编辑器面板中,单击 组件列表 中的一个或多个...

迭代器功能说明

单元中组件的数据可由自身数据源驱动,或者迭代器中获取。注意 迭代器的一级子图层只能是迭代单元,不能是普通组件,普通组件包含在迭代单元内。迭代器功能操作 操作 说明 生成迭代器 在区块编辑器面板中,单击 组件列表 中的一个或多个...

脚本语法

重要 解析处理的数据源必须转换为JSON格式数据,即数组或者嵌套的JSON数据。定义字段,然后获取payload属性,并赋值给该字段。定义字段标识符和数据类型的规则,请参见本文下方的“标识符”和“数据类型”。脚本文件支持使用JSONPath...

ARRAYS_OVERLAP

数组中的元素可以为如下类型:TINYINT、SMALLINT、INT、BIGINT FLOAT、DOUBLE BOOLEAN DECIMAL、DECIMALVAL DATE、DATETIME、TIMESTAMP、IntervalDayTime、IntervalYearMonth STRING、BINARY、VARCHAR、CHAR ARRAY、STRUCT、MAP 返回说明...

关联数组

ANALYST:100 CLERK:200 MANAGER:300 SALESMAN:400 PRESIDENT:500 二维关联数组 二维关联数组是嵌套的关联数组二维关联数组是一维关联数组,可以同时使用两个键关联到最内层关联数组的元素。二维关联数组的基本特征和关联数组相同。...

JSON函数

字段样例 Results:[{"EndTime":1626314920},{"RawResultCount":1}]查询和分析语句*|SELECT sum(cast(json_extract_scalar(Results,'$.1.RawResultCount')AS bigint))查询和分析结果 SPL Results 字段中获取 RawResultCount 字段的。...

流量标签TrafficLabel说明

展开查看$getLabel(labelName)详细说明 表示网关Pod或Sidecar容器所属Pod的标签中获取名称为 labelName 的标签,并将该附加到出口流量上。如果 labelName 为空,默认工作负载Pod上的标签 ASM_TRAFFIC_TAG 取值。例如,以下工作负载...

如何查看模板的Map

ROSTemplateFormatVersion:'2015-09-01' Parameters:InputMap:Type:Json Outputs:value_a:Value:Fn:Select:key_a-InputMap 您也可以直接在模板构造字典获取值。ROSTemplateFormatVersion:'2015-09-01' Resources:Mock:Type:MockResource ...

JSON函数和操作符

text→boolean 文本字符串是否作为JSON值中的顶级键或数组元素存在?'{"a":1,"b":2}':jsonb?'b'→t '["a","b","c"]':jsonb?'b'→t jsonb?text[]→boolean 文本数组中的字符串是否作为顶级键或数组元素存在?'{"a":1,"b":2,"c":3}':jsonb?...

赋值节点

赋值节点下游获取赋值节点结果集outputs时,需要根据outputs具体情况,以${参数名} 的格式,使用 一维数组二维数组 的方式在代码中获取赋值节点传递的结果集、或结果集中的指定数据。赋值节点使用流程 配置赋值节点:定义outputs结果集...

GetAsyncResult-获取异步函数执行结果

请求参数 名称 类型 必填 描述 示例 TaskId string 是 异步服务的任务 ID Chat接口中获取TASK_ID AgentKey string 否 业务空间 key,不设置则访问默认业务空间,key 在主账号业务管理页面获取 ac627989eb4f8a98ed05fd098bbae5_p_...

GetAsyncResult-获取异步函数执行结果

请求参数 名称 类型 必填 描述 示例 TaskId string 是 异步服务的任务 ID Chat接口中获取TASK_ID AgentKey string 否 业务空间 key,不设置则访问默认业务空间,key 在主账号业务管理页面获取 ac627989eb4f8a98ed05fd098bbae5_p_...

数组类型相关函数

本文为您介绍数组类型相关函数的语法、说明、参数、示例和返回。arr_concat|arr_insert|arr_remove|arr_sort|arr_len arr_concat 项目 描述 语法 arr_concat(tbl,[sep])说明 使用arr_concat将字段表的字符串按照指定的字符进行连接。...
共有200条 < 1 2 3 4 ... 200 >
跳转至: GO
产品推荐
云服务器 安全管家服务 安全中心
这些文档可能帮助您
云监控 风险识别 实时数仓 Hologres 云原生数据仓库AnalyticDB MySQL版 云数据库 RDS 弹性公网IP
新人特惠 爆款特惠 最新活动 免费试用